在城市化进程不断加快的今天,高楼大厦已经成为现代都市的标志之一。然而,随着建筑高度的不断增加,如何确保这些高楼的安全成为了一个重要议题。本文将详细解析民用建筑高度的计算方法,并提供一些实用的习题攻略,帮助读者更好地理解高楼安全的重要性。
民用建筑高度计算概述
民用建筑高度的计算是一个涉及多个因素的综合过程,主要包括以下几个方面:
1. 设计规范
不同国家和地区对于民用建筑的高度有不同的设计规范。这些规范通常基于地震、风荷载、材料强度等多方面因素制定。
2. 地质条件
建筑物的地基承载力是决定建筑高度的重要因素。地质条件较差的地区,建筑高度会受到限制。
3. 结构形式
不同的结构形式对建筑高度有不同的影响。例如,框架结构、剪力墙结构、框架-剪力墙结构等。
4. 抗震性能
建筑物的抗震性能与其高度密切相关。在地震多发地区,建筑高度会受到严格限制。
民用建筑高度计算详解
以下是一些常用的民用建筑高度计算方法:
1. 按照设计规范计算
以我国为例,民用建筑高度计算可以参考《建筑抗震设计规范》(GB 50011-2010)。
代码示例(Python):
# 定义计算建筑高度函数
def calculate_height(floor_area, story_height, design_code):
# 根据设计规范计算建筑高度
height = floor_area * story_height * design_code
return height
# 假设
floor_area = 1000 # 平方米
story_height = 3 # 米
design_code = 1.0 # 设计规范系数
# 计算建筑高度
height = calculate_height(floor_area, story_height, design_code)
print(f"建筑高度为:{height}米")
2. 根据地质条件计算
地质条件较差的地区,建筑高度需要根据地基承载力进行计算。
代码示例(Python):
# 定义计算建筑高度函数
def calculate_height_by_ground_capacity(ground_capacity, design_code):
# 根据地基承载力计算建筑高度
height = ground_capacity * design_code
return height
# 假设
ground_capacity = 1000 # 千牛/平方米
design_code = 1.0 # 设计规范系数
# 计算建筑高度
height = calculate_height_by_ground_capacity(ground_capacity, design_code)
print(f"建筑高度为:{height}米")
民用建筑高度计算习题攻略
以下是一些关于民用建筑高度计算的习题,帮助读者巩固所学知识:
习题1
某地区设计规范系数为1.2,一栋民用建筑占地面积为800平方米,每层楼高为3米。请计算该建筑的最大高度。
习题2
某地区地质条件较差,地基承载力为600千牛/平方米。设计规范系数为1.0。请计算该地区建筑的最大高度。
习题3
一栋民用建筑采用框架-剪力墙结构,抗震等级为二级。每层楼高为3米,占地面积为1200平方米。请计算该建筑的最大高度。
总结
本文详细介绍了民用建筑高度的计算方法,并提供了实用的习题攻略。在实际工程中,建筑高度的计算需要综合考虑多种因素,确保建筑安全。希望本文能为读者提供有益的参考。
